    Ah, I see.

    2 things:

    1) Why is radarbox TCP chosen? Please scroll down to Beast Receiver TCP.

    2) The TCP/IP server for that I/O settings should be 30003. Just like the previous image I uploaded.

    Port 30334 should be entered at another window. here is the print screen:

    TCP IP PP.jpg

    Click Setup TCP/IP Client.

    Then you will go into here:

    TCP IP PP2.jpg

    Here you insert your IP address of your FR24 receiver and port number 30334. i.e 192.168.x.x:30334

  • North Borneo Radar
    replied
    Originally posted by usernil View Post
    Anyone here could help me set up planeplotter with FR24 receiver ....I am using Paid Version....
    Erm... the standard answer is contact support@fr24.com

    but I also got what you got... so here is a bit of tips:

    Get your FR24 receiver IP address. You will need to know that (easier if you set it to a fixed IP which you can do from the status page).

    Find out which port you want to use from the FR24 receiver status page (I use RAW). Write both of them down if you can't remember them.

    Go to PP, make sure the IO settings is Beast TCP, highlighted.

    After that go to Options>mode s receiver>beast receiver>set up TCP/IP client>key in your FR24 receiver IP address& port no: ie. 192.168.x.x:xxxxx

    Press the green button to start processing. If all is well aircrafts will show on PP.

    Obviously... sharing is disabled.

    Hope this helps.

  • SoCalBrian
    replied
    You can link the FR24 box receiver to the Planeplotter software.
    You just can't upload the FR24 box receiver data to the Planeplotter Network. That option needs to be unchecked, turned off in the Planeplotter settings.
